dc.description.abstractAn increasing proportion of secondary school in Plateau State achieve results in the school certification which are inadequate for admission into institutions of higher learning. This group of students is very likely to seek employment after completing their course. The purpose of the study is to consider the relevance of the secondary school experience to employment in Plateau State in terms of the content of the secondary education available to students and the attitudes and expectations they imbibe while in schools.en_US
